API 分页
默认页面大小为 100 个结果。您可以更改页面大小限制。允许的最大大小为 250。
当响应包含多个页面时,它包含一个游标,您可以使用它来请求下一页。
例如,假设您想要获取所有活动工作流,每次 150 个。
获取第一页:
| # 对于自托管的 n8n 实例
curl -X 'GET' \
'<N8N_HOST>:<N8N_PORT>/<N8N_PATH>/api/v<version-number>/workflows?active=true&limit=150' \
-H 'accept: application/json' \
-H 'X-N8N-API-KEY: <your-api-key>'
# 对于 n8n Cloud
curl -X 'GET' \
'<your-cloud-instance>/api/v<version-number>/workflows?active=true&limit=150' \
-H 'accept: application/json' \
-H 'X-N8N-API-KEY: <your-api-key>'
|
响应是 JSON 格式,并包含一个 nextCursor
值。这是一个示例响应。
| {
"data": [
// 响应包含每个工作流的对象
{
// 工作流数据
}
],
"nextCursor": "MTIzZTQ1NjctZTg5Yi0xMmQzLWE0NTYtNDI2NjE0MTc0MDA"
}
|
然后请求下一页:
| # 对于自托管的 n8n 实例
curl -X 'GET' \
'<N8N_HOST>:<N8N_PORT>/<N8N_PATH>/api/v<version-number>/workflows?active=true&limit=150&cursor=MTIzZTQ1NjctZTg5Yi0xMmQzLWE0NTYtNDI2NjE0MTc0MDA' \
-H 'accept: application/json'
# 对于 n8n Cloud
curl -X 'GET' \
'<your-cloud-instance>/api/v<version-number>/workflows?active=true&limit=150&cursor=MTIzZTQ1NjctZTg5Yi0xMmQzLWE0NTYtNDI2NjE0MTc0MDA' \
-H 'accept: application/json'
|